## Approvals: Offline Mode — Trailmark Survey

Welcome aboard. Offline mode in Trailmark caches survey forms and queued submissions locally, then syncs when connectivity returns. Because cached data may include landowner notes, any change to encryption-at-rest, cache retention, or the sync conflict policy requires a documented approval before release. Submit your proposal through the approvals board and wait for written sign-off. Final approval authority for all offline-mode changes rests with one person.

named custodian: Brivan Eliath Quenox Frador

Subject: Scanner cut-over wrap-up

Hi,

Welcome aboard. Last night we completed the cut-over of the Larkspool barcode scanner integration to the new decode service. All lanes at the Fennwick depot are now on the new path, and the legacy listener is retired. For your setup, the service's current configuration values follow below.

service settings:
PRAIX_LOG_LEVEL=error
PRAIX_METRICS_HOST=metrics.praix.qorvelcorp.corp
PRAIX_POOL_SIZE=16

Hey Marisol,

Quick handover before I'm out. The driver-assignment heuristic in RouteNimble now lives in the plugin layer, so external authors can override scoring weights directly. Docs are thin, sorry — ping Teodor if stuck. Plugins read assignment state from the heuristics replica, so point your dev harness at this connection:

primary connection of yagep-kahip = redis://giliel_svc:zYiKsLL2PLpfPL@db-348f.xolmarsys.corp:5432/fenwyn